Overview

An mRNA-encoded trispecific T-cell engager (TCE) designed to target CD19, BCMA, and CD3. Developed by METiS TechBio, this therapeutic utilizes an optimized mRNA sequence formulated in a novel lipid nanoparticle (LNP) to induce broad depletion of B cells and plasma cells. The construct consists of a CD3-binding scFv fused with VHH domains specific for CD19 and BCMA. It is intended for the treatment of B-cell-driven cancers, such as multiple myeloma, and autoimmune diseases like systemic lupus erythematosus (SLE). Preclinical data suggests potent B-cell killing and a favorable safety profile with reduced cytokine release compared to traditional protein-based engagers, particularly when administered subcutaneously. The LNP delivery system is designed for preferential biodistribution to secondary lymphoid organs, including the spleen, bone marrow, and lymph nodes.
